Operating Activities
Business activities related to the day-to-day operations that generate revenue, such as sales and purchasing of inventory.
Indirect Method
In accounting, a method used to calculate cash flows from operating activities by starting with net income and adjusting for non-cash transactions.
Accumulated Depreciation
The total amount of depreciation expense that has been recorded against a fixed asset since it was put into use.
Cash Dividends
The distribution of a portion of a company's earnings, decided by the board of directors, to a class of its shareholders in the form of cash.
